Exclusion criteria
Exclusion criteria: 1. History of transient ischaemic attack (TIA) or cerebrovascular accident (ischaemic or haemorrhagic), severe head trauma, intracranial haemorrhage, intracranial neoplasm, arteriovenous malformation, aneurysm, or proliferative retinopathy. 2. Findings on TCD: Current or previous values for time averaged mean of the maximum velocity (TAMMV) that are Conditional or Abnormal. Patients with Conditional TAMMV values or higher (>=153 cm/sec using TCD imaging technique [TCDi] which is corresponding to >=170 cm/sec by the non-imaging technique). Both the middle cerebral artery and the internal carotid artery should be considered. Any other criteria that would locally be considered as TCD indications for chronic transfusion would also exclude the patient. 3. Design outcomes
Primary
| Measure | Time frame |
|---|---|
| To compare the effect of ticagrelor vs placebo for the reduction of VOCs, which is the composite of painful crisis and/or ACS, in paediatric patients with SCD Timepoint: Entire Duration of Trial- 52 Weeks | — |
